メモ > 技術 > サービス: AmazonSNS > Android: アプリにFirebaseからPushを送信
Android: アプリにFirebaseからPushを送信
Firebaseでプロジェクトのページを開く。
左メニュー → 実行 → Messaging → 新しいキャンペーンを送信 → 通知
通知のタイトル: テストのタイトル
通知テキスト: テストのテキスト
ターゲット: ユーザーセグメント
ターゲットとするユーザー: アプリ net.refirio.pushtest1
スケジュール: 現在
その他必要に応じて設定し、「確認」をクリックすると確認画面が表示されるので、「公開」をクリックすると送信できる。
数分間待っていると、以下のログが表示された。
2023-09-15 19:18:09.706 5883-8376 MyFirebaseMsgService net.refirio.pushtest1 D showNotification Title: プッシュ通知テスト
2023-09-15 19:18:09.706 5883-8376 MyFirebaseMsgService net.refirio.pushtest1 D showNotification Body: null
なお、この時点ではタイトルが「通知タイトル」、本文が「通知メッセージ」という内容で通知が表示される。
(ソースコード内で文言を固定しているため。)
※届くまで5分ほどかかるみたい?AmazonSNS経由なら比較的早く届くみたい?
AmazonSNSが色々良い感じに処理してくれているのかもしれない。
最終的にはAmazonSNSから送信するので、ここでは「時間はかかるが届くようだ」くらいまでの確認でいいか。
Jetpack Compose で Permission を要求する方法
https://zenn.dev/kaleidot725/articles/2021-11-13-jc-permission
Advertisement